在线数据分析工具选型指南:从业务需求到技术实现

一、业务展示场景:数据可视化与业务逻辑的深度融合
在业务监控大屏、管理驾驶舱等场景中,数据展示的核心诉求是”清晰传递业务状态”。这类工具需具备三个技术特性:低代码配置能力、实时数据同步机制、多维度钻取功能。

  1. 低代码可视化引擎
    某低代码平台提供的可视化组件库,包含30+种业务图表类型(指标卡、趋势图、地理分布等),支持通过拖拽方式完成仪表盘搭建。其核心优势在于与业务系统的深度集成:可直接绑定数据库查询语句作为数据源,支持设置自动刷新间隔(最低1秒级),且提供权限控制模块实现数据分级展示。例如某零售企业通过该平台构建的门店监控大屏,将客流量、转化率、库存水位等12个核心指标集成在单页面中,管理层可实时查看全国门店运营状态。

  2. 交互式分析组件
    某在线图表工具提供的交互组件库,包含时间轴筛选器、多级下钻按钮、数据对比开关等交互元素。以销售分析场景为例,用户可通过时间轴快速切换日/周/月视图,点击区域地图下钻至城市级数据,使用对比开关查看同比/环比变化。该工具支持导出SVG矢量图和交互式HTML报告,满足不同展示终端的需求。

  3. 实时数据管道
    构建实时业务大屏的关键在于数据同步机制。某流式计算平台提供的实时数据接入方案,支持通过WebSocket协议推送数据变更,配合前端框架的虚拟滚动技术,可实现万级数据点的毫秒级渲染。某金融交易系统采用该方案后,将行情数据延迟从3秒降低至200毫秒以内。

二、快速建模场景:从数据导入到分析报告的全流程优化
对于需要频繁进行临时分析的场景,工具需具备快速数据接入、智能建模、自动化报告生成等能力。这类工具的技术演进方向是AI增强分析。

  1. 智能数据准备
    某在线分析平台提供的AutoETL功能,可自动识别CSV/Excel文件中的数据类型,通过机器学习算法推荐最佳清洗规则。例如处理销售数据时,系统能自动识别日期格式、拆分地址字段、填充缺失值,将原本需要2小时的数据准备工作缩短至10分钟。该平台还支持通过自然语言指令进行数据转换,如”将订单金额大于10000的记录标记为VIP”。

  2. 自动化建模引擎
    主流云服务商提供的智能分析服务,内置200+种统计模型和机器学习算法。用户只需上传数据并指定分析目标(如预测销售额、分类客户群体),系统即可自动完成特征工程、模型训练和评估。某电商企业使用该服务构建的商品推荐模型,通过集成梯度提升树和深度学习算法,将点击率提升了18%。

  3. 自然语言生成报告
    某分析工具的NLG模块,可将分析结果自动转化为业务报告。系统能理解统计指标的业务含义,生成包含数据解读、趋势分析、异常检测等内容的完整报告。例如输入”分析Q3各区域销售额”,系统会输出:”华东区销售额同比增长15%,主要得益于上海分公司的新客户开发;华南区同比下降8%,需重点关注广州团队的业绩波动”。

三、交互分析场景:支持复杂业务逻辑的深度探索
对于需要多维度交叉分析的场景,工具需具备OLAP引擎、自定义计算、协同分析等高级功能。这类工具的技术架构通常采用列式存储和向量化计算。

  1. 多维数据分析引擎
    某开源分析平台提供的MDX查询引擎,支持创建包含10+个维度的复杂分析模型。用户可通过拖拽方式构建交叉表,系统自动生成最优查询计划。例如分析用户行为数据时,可同时按地区、设备类型、访问时段、页面类型等维度进行分组统计,并计算转化率、留存率等复合指标。

  2. 自定义计算脚本
    专业分析工具提供的计算脚本功能,允许用户编写JavaScript或Python代码实现复杂业务逻辑。某金融分析平台支持在仪表盘中嵌入自定义函数,例如计算风险价值(VaR)、构建信用评分模型等。这些脚本可保存为模板供团队复用,确保分析方法的一致性。

  3. 协同分析环境
    某云分析服务提供的协作功能,支持多人同时编辑分析看板,实时同步修改内容。系统记录完整的操作历史,可回滚至任意版本。某咨询公司使用该功能后,将项目交付周期从2周缩短至5天,团队成员的协作效率提升60%。

四、技术选型建议:根据场景匹配工具类型

  1. 业务展示场景:优先选择支持实时数据同步、提供丰富业务图表类型、具备权限控制功能的工具。关注数据刷新延迟、并发访问支持等性能指标。

  2. 快速建模场景:选择内置AI建模能力、支持自然语言交互的工具。评估模型库的丰富程度、自动化程度以及与现有数据系统的集成能力。

  3. 交互分析场景:关注OLAP引擎性能、自定义计算支持、协作功能等特性。对于超大规模数据集,需验证工具的分布式计算能力。

结语:在线数据分析工具的技术演进呈现出三个明显趋势:低代码化降低使用门槛、AI增强提升分析效率、云原生架构支持弹性扩展。开发者在选型时应重点关注工具的技术架构、扩展能力以及与现有系统的兼容性,而非单纯比较功能点数量。建议通过POC测试验证工具在真实业务场景中的表现,特别是数据量、并发量、响应时间等关键指标。